Understanding Stomach 36: Location and Importance

Stomach 36 is found on the lower leg, about four finger-widths below the kneecap and one finger-width lateral (toward the outside) from the tibia (shinbone). This vital acupuncture point is part of the Stomach Meridian and plays a crucial role in TCM’s extensive network of energy channels.

Revered for its ability to boost physical and mental stamina, ST36 is a go-to point for acupuncturists and practitioners of acupressure. Its significance lies in its potential to enhance overall vitality and immune function, making it an essential part of holistic health care.

How to Stimulate Stomach 36

There are several effective ways to stimulate Stomach 36, depending on what works best for you:

1. Acupressure

To locate ST36, measure about four finger-widths below your kneecap and one finger-width to the outside of your shinbone. Use your fingers to apply firm but gentle pressure in a circular motion for about 2 to 3 minutes on each leg. This can be done daily to maintain overall health or more frequently if you’re addressing specific issues.

2. Acupuncture

For a more precise stimulation, consider acupuncture. This technique involves inserting thin needles into the ST36 point and should only be performed by a licensed acupuncturist. Acupuncture can provide deeper stimulation, making it particularly effective for chronic conditions.

3. Moxibustion

Moxibustion is a traditional therapy that involves burning mugwort near the ST36 point to warm and stimulate the area. This method enhances the effects of acupressure and acupuncture by adding heat, which invigorates Qi and blood flow.

4. Electrostimulation

Some practitioners use electrostimulation, where a small electrical current is passed through the needles placed at ST36. This technique can intensify stimulation and is commonly used in modern acupuncture practices to enhance therapeutic effects.
